Instructions

  1. Prepare the oven and pans
    Preheat the oven to 450°F (230°C). Generously grease a 12-cup popover pan or standard muffin tin with butter, making sure to coat the rims and inside of each cup thoroughly.
  2. Mix the batter
    In a large bowl, whisk together the flour and salt. In a separate bowl, whisk the eggs until frothy, then whisk in the warm milk and melted butter. Gradually add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ients, whisking constantly until the batter is smooth with no lumps. Let the batter rest for 10 minutes.
  3. Add the cheese and walnuts
    Gently fold 3/4 cup of the crumbled blue cheese, 1/2 cup of the toasted walnuts, 1 tablespoon of thyme leaves, and black pepper into the batter, being careful not to overmix.
  4. Fill the pans
    Fill each prepared cup about 2/3 full with batter. Don't overfill as the popovers will rise dramatically during baking.
  5. Bake the popovers
    Place the pan in the preheated oven and bake for 20 minutes at 450°F. Without opening the oven door, reduce the temperature to 350°F (175°C) and continue baking for an additional 10 minutes until the popovers are golden brown and puffed.
  6. Add the toppings
    Remove the popovers from the oven and immediately pierce the top of each with a small knife to release steam. Top each popover with the remaining blue cheese, walnuts, and thyme leaves. Drizzle with honey if desired.
  7. Serve
    Serve the popovers immediately while hot and puffed. They are best enjoyed fresh from the oven as they will gradually deflate as they cool.
